Land use mix (LUM) has been associated with cycling and walking, but whether changes in LUM relate to changes in cycling/walking is less known.
Our objective was to study the effect of LUM on cycling/walking in two Dutch aging cohorts using data with 10?years of follow-up.
Data from 1183 respondents from the Health and Living Conditions of the Population of Eindhoven and Surroundings (GLOBE) study and 918 respondents from the Longitudinal Aging Study Amsterdam (LASA) were linked to LUM in 1000-m sausage network buffers at three time-points. Cycling/walking outcomes were harmonized to include average minutes spent cycling/walking per week. Data was pooled and limited to respondents that did not relocate between follow-up waves. Various risk factors such as inflammation disrupt barrier function through down-regulation of these proteins and promote vascular diseases such as atherosclerosis. Previous studies have demonstrated that aged garlic extract (AGE) and its sulfur-containing constituents exert the protective effects against several vascular diseases such as atherosclerosis. In this study, we examined whether AGE and its sulfur-containing constituents improve the endothelial barrier dysfunction elicited by a pro-inflammatory cytokine, Tumor-necrosis factor-α (TNF-α), and explored their mode of action on TNF-α signaling pathway.
Human umbilical vein endothelial cells (HUVECs) were treated with test substances in the presence of TNF-α for various time periods. Extracellular ATP, the levels of which significantly change during epileptic seizures, activates specific receptors leading to an increase of intracellular free Caconcentration ([Ca]). Here, we aimed to functionally characterize human microglia obtained from cortices of subjects with temporal lobe epilepsy, focusing on the Ca-mediated response triggered by purinergic signaling.
Fura-2 based fluorescence microscopy was used to measure [Ca]in primary cultures of human microglial cells obtained from surgical specimens. The perforated patch-clamp technique, which preserves the cytoplasmic milieu, was used to measure ATP-evoked Ca-dependent whole-cell currents.
In human microglia extracellular ATP evoked [Ca]increases depend on Caentry from the extracellular space and on Camobilization from intracellular compartments. However, substantial unmet need for modern contraceptive methods (MCMs) persists in this region. Current literature highlights multi-level barriers, including socio-cultural norms that discourage the use of MCMs. This paper explores women's choices and decision-making around MCM use and examines whether integrating FP services with childhood immunisations influenced women's perceptions of, and decision to use, an MCM.
94 semi-structured interviews and 21 focus group discussions with women, health providers, and community members (N?=?253) were conducted in health facilities and outreach clinics where an intervention was delivering integrated FP and childhood immunisation services in Benin, Ethiopia, Kenya, Malawi and Uganda. Data were coded using Nvivo software and an analytical framework was developed to support interpretative and thematic analyses on women's decision-making about MCM use.
